How are you trying to mate them? I'd mate one with a concentric to the location its meant to be so its constrained, and then use 3 separate gear mates to all of the other ones in a 1:1 ratio, the two adjacent gears will turn the opposite direction of the parent gear and the far one will spin the same direction, so one set will need to have the gear mate reversed

Is this the same generative design frame thats been posted for months and was designed without taking the anisotropic material properties of 3d printing into account? I know you mention that printing orientation should help for the most exposed areas, but this style of design acts like a truss, and thus all forces move down the the parts in a line, so any truss that isn't aligned with the print layers is inherently going to be a weak point since forces are transferred throughout a truss structure. How do you address this?

Oh hey! Thats my hometown! The reason for this is that its a fairly long downsloping hill into the busiest intersection in town. The general idea was to force a slower pace for bikes, scooters, and boards, especially as going down the hill leads to the community center, library, and skate park. The waves have been there long before the new development happening in the right of the photo, so its certainly not new or to weave around old trees, just to slow people down. It may look infuriating at a glance but its genuinely meant to keep kids and teens safer.

To extend on OP, the generalized though process of those who consider suicide is they just want everything to stop. In the moment, it feels like a hard stop, death, is the only answer. The semicolon represents that what they need is a pause, a breath to let them recollect and recover, and then their story may go on. Its a simply beautiful way to convey that idea

If youre looking for loose floaty snow, you want a tired with deep but close together lugs and some small grooves. Snow sticks better to snow than it does to rubber, so you want something that can grab a little bit of snow and hold onto it. Thinks like KO2s are really good for that

Shooting next to an open room (or archway) will wake up sleepers a certain distance away, decreasing for each door, I believe it is 30, 20, and 10 m for 3 consecutive doors, and then past that it won't wake anything, but that puts a cap on the total distance. So if youre 30 m away from an open door, it shouldn't wake up anything in there (I believe dont quote me). Alarms and scouts both spawn enemies 2 rooms away from the player/scout that went off. This includes unexplored rooms in that same zone, which is what busted open that door. The only one that is different is uplinks, as those will always spawn in the same zone, even if thats just one room away.
